Establishing Training Facilities for Low Element Challenge Courses offered by CSDI (Nantou Office)

To diversify the learning methods adopted in civil servant training programs while fostering relevant core competencies, such as teamwork, communication, and problem-solving, the CSDI (Nantou Office) has completed the establishment of training facilities designed for five low element challenge courses, including “Island Hopping,” “Spider Webbing,” “Whale-Watching,” “Bagua Footworking,” and “Mohawk Walking.” Through “feet-on” activities mentioned above, these courses are expected to enhance the mutual trust, collaboration, strategic planning, and decision-making among the participants.
